Gummersbach's U17 is subject to Dormagen: Clear defeat in the top game!

In the B-Youth Bundesliga top game, VfL Gummersbach met the superior favorites TSV Bayer Dormagen and had to admit defeat with a clear 30:22. This was an important match for both teams because they were without loss of points up to this point. The game took place in Gummersbach, where many spectators had gathered to see the talents of these young handball teams.

From the beginning it was shown that the Dormageners would take control of the game. They quickly led 5: 3 and expanded their lead to 10: 4 until the 19th minute. Gummersbach's coach Maciej Dmytruszynski said that his team had difficulties in prevailing against the defensive strategy of the Dormagener. "We did not start well and had too much respect for Dormagen's 3-2-1 defense. We also made many technical mistakes and gave good chances," he reported. These errors resulted in two missed seven meters and other unused occasions.

first half under control of the Dormagener

The first half did not bring a turn to shorten the deficit despite some attempts. After a few good actions, they were still at 10:15 at half -time. "In defense we were too passive against the strong single players of Dormagen," Dmytruszynski analyzed the weak defense, which led to it lost numerous duels and collected simple goals.

In the second half, the Gummersbacher tried to improve their performance and started with the aim of catching up. First of all, this plan seemed to work when they shortened to 16:20 after 43 minutes. But the Dormageners countered quickly and soon led significantly with 25:18. In the crucial minutes of the game, also known as crunchtime, Gummersbach had to recognize the superiority of the Dormagener, which extended their lead to the final score of 30:22.

conclusion of the trainer and outlook

dmytruszynski was at least partially satisfied with the increase in his team in the second half: "The defense was better and we found more solutions against their defensive. But then we had phases again like in the first half that ultimately cost us the game." Ultimately, the victory deserves the TSV Bayer Dormagen, which was the stronger team that day. Coach Dmytruszynski also expressed congratulations on the Dormagener: "You deservedly won."

The game not only illustrated the strengths and weaknesses of the two teams, but is also important for the overall ranking of the league, since it shows that Dormagen appears as a serious title candidate this season.
